State-Space Transition for Unforced Nonlinear Systems
To unforced nonlinear systems, based on the state equation of control systems, the definition of state space transition is given. First of all, the state space transition of the system is obtained by utilizing the solution of related linear homogeneous equation; then based on the differential equation in series forms, the state space transition of the state equation of the unforced nonlinear system is given by heuristic method. The method in this paper can be used to the design of nonlinear control systems.
